Top 2023-2024 Cybersecurity Trends to Watch
1. AI-Powered Cyber Threats
AI is both a tool and a weapon in cybersecurity. Hackers are leveraging AI to launch more advanced phishing attacks, automate malware deployment, and bypass traditional security measures. Organizations must implement AI-driven defense mechanisms to counter these threats effectively.
2. Rise of Ransomware-as-a-Service (RaaS)
The 2023-2024 cybersecurity trends indicate a rise in Ransomware-as-a-Service (RaaS), where cybercriminals sell pre-built ransomware kits. This model lowers the barrier for entry, leading to an increase in ransomware attacks across industries.
3. Zero Trust Security Models
A proactive security approach, Zero Trust, assumes that threats exist inside and outside the network. Organizations adopting Zero Trust frameworks improve security by verifying every request before granting access.
4. Quantum Computing & Cryptographic Risks
Quantum computing threatens current encryption standards. Businesses must explore post-quantum cryptography solutions to protect sensitive data from future attacks.
5. The Expansion of IoT-Based Attacks
The growing number of IoT devices introduces more vulnerabilities. 2023-2024 cybersecurity trends predict an increase in IoT-targeted cyberattacks, requiring stronger security protocols and regular software updates.
Adapting to the Trends
To stay ahead of cyber threats, businesses and individuals must:
-
Implement AI-Driven Security Solutions: Machine learning models can detect threats faster and mitigate risks effectively.
-
Enhance Cyber Hygiene Practices: Regular software updates, strong password policies, and employee training are critical.
-
Adopt Multi-Factor Authentication (MFA): Reduces the risk of unauthorized access.
-
Utilize Threat Intelligence Platforms: Real-time monitoring and analysis help predict and prevent cyberattacks.
